Felix Burmeister is a 36-year-old football player who plays as a center back, born on 9 de março de 1990, who is right-footed. Follow Felix Burmeister on FotMob for live match updates, detailed statistics, career history, transfer news, FotMob ratings, and comprehensive performance analytics.

In the 2020/2021 2. Bundesliga season, Felix Burmeister has recorded 0 goals, 0 assists, 135 minutes, an average FotMob rating of 6.36, 1 yellow card.

Felix Burmeister's career has also included time at Eintracht Braunschweig, Vasas Budapest, Arminia Bielefeld, Hannover 96, and Hannover 96 II.

Throughout their career, Felix Burmeister has won 1 title: 3. Liga (2014/2015) with Arminia Bielefeld.
